Gene/Insert
-
Gene/Insert namecatalytic mutant of Cas9 endonuclease from the Campylobacter jejuni Type II CRISPR/Cas system
-
Alt nameCjeCas9
-
SpeciesSynthetic
-
Insert Size (bp)2949
-
Mutationchanged Asp 8 to Ala and His 559 to Ala
